I agree with everything you say. I'm just splitting hairs with your comment about Gamboa having "some speed advantages." I think Yuri is among the fastest fighters in the business. His speed advantage is pretty substantial. Gamboa relies much more on his natural speed, athleticism (another advantage) and aggression than Lopez. JuanMa is a better technician, more accurate and possibly hits harder.
Lopez has the ability to take Gamboa out with one shot. Yuri knows that, and will be much more cautious with JuanMa than many people think. On the other hand, Gamboa has the ability to land a greater volume of punches. An accumulation of hard punches might result in a mid to late TKO. It will be a great fight, if it gets made while both men are at their physical peak. At this rate, they may not meet for another couple of years.
